Taz to be inducted into the 2300 Arena Hardcore Hall of Fame this weeekend

AEW commentator Taz will be inducted into the 2300 Arena’s Hardcore Hall of Fame this Saturday night during the episode of Collision.

The announcement was made after Dynamite went off the air last night, with the locker room coming out along with Hook and Taz’s wife.

AEW President Tony Khan said that the last time he was inside the 2300 Arena, he was 13 years old and was wearing a Taz t-shirt, and it was only fitting to end the first night honoring Taz. He then dropped the news that Saturday, they would pay tribute by raising his banner inside the arena.

Taz, who was completely unaware of the news, said that it was nice that both his wife and son kayfabed him! He thanked the AEW fans and roster and said that while he gets paid to talk, he was actually speechless.

Taz was a mainstay at the 2300 Arena during the ECW glory days where several career highlights took place.

The Human Suplex Machine becomes the 26th inductee into the arena’s HOF.
